Что такое командные-сценарии и в-каких-сферах скрипты задействуются
Скрипты представляют собой малые программные-блоки а-также комплекты команд, что выполняются без-ручного-участия в-рамках программной оболочки а-также операционной платформы. Такие-сценарии используются для облегчения повторяющихся шагов, автоматизации операций плюс администрирования многочисленными компонентами цифрового инструментария. Командные-сценарии обычно-не требуют многоэтапной сборки и чаще зачастую исполняются up x исполняющей-средой, что формирует сценарии практичными ради ускоренного запуска и корректировки.
В нынешних электронных средах командные-сценарии играют важную функцию, потому-что дают-возможность соединить различные элементы в общую операционную последовательность, при-этом еще оптимизируют проведение действий без-постоянного-контроля вмешательства пользователя. В-рамках реальных случаях плюс обзорных разборах, например как up x, возможно понять, как командные-сценарии позволяют ускорять сценарии обработки сведений, взаимодействия интерфейсов и контроля ресурсами.
Главные характеристики сценариев
Командные-сценарии выделяются от обычных приложений собственной простотой а-также понятностью схемы. Такие-сценарии чаще-всего формируются с-помощью набора команд, которые запускаются по очереди. Данный принцип формирует скрипты ясными плюс простыми ради корректировки. В-случае нужды ап икс официальный сайт корректировки можно добавить сразу, без сложных процедур подготовки а-также развертывания.
Кроме-того важной существенной особенностью выступает исполнение-интерпретатором. Командные-сценарии запускаются с помощью профильных интерпретаторов, что читают текст построчно. Подобная-модель позволяет мгновенно оценивать итог выполнения плюс своевременно устранять сбои. Подобный принцип в-частности удобен во-время подготовке и валидации многочисленных функций.
Скрипт чаще-всего выполняет конкретную задачу и не-обязательно постоянно считается самостоятельным программой. Сценарий имеет-возможность выполняться в-рамках web-браузера, backend-сервера, редактора-кода, программного-кода, системной среды или внешней утилиты. Посредством данному-подходу сценарии регулярно становятся объединяющим элементом среди уже готовыми системами. Такие-сценарии помогают не создавать решение с-самого нуля, зато расширять систему нужными операциями ап икс.
Частые языки с-целью написания скриптов
Существует большое-количество технологий кодинга, созданных для написания сценариев. Из наиболее часто-используемых возможно отметить JavaScript, Питон, PHP, командный-Bash плюс PowerShell. Любой из данных-инструментов используется во конкретной нише плюс содержит собственные особенности.
JavaScript часто используется во веб-разработке для разработки динамических блоков на веб-страницах. Python up x задействуется ради оптимизации, обработки информации плюс написания дополнительных инструментов. Bash-shell и PowerShell-среда применяются ради контроля рабочими средами плюс проведения операций в слое серверной-системы а-также устройства.
серверный-PHP часто используется во серверной стороне web-проектов. Посредством этого-языка применением проверяются формы, формируются страницы, проводятся команды ко базе информации плюс создаются ответы в браузера. Командный-Bash обычно используется в POSIX-подобных средах, когда требуется сразу запустить последовательность инструкций. PowerShell популярен в экосистеме Windows и дает-возможность администрировать документами, сервисами, параметрами и сетевыми компонентами ап икс официальный сайт.
Скрипты во web-разработке
Онлайн-ресурсы активно задействуют командные-сценарии для обработки пользовательских событий плюс мгновенного изменения содержимого экрана. К-примеру, во-время активации кнопки либо вводе формы выполняется скрипт, он валидирует переданные сведения а-также направляет сведения на сервер. Это помогает создавать удобные а-также интерактивные страницы.
Внутри стороне хостинга скрипты разбирают команды, обмениваются между хранилищами данных а-также создают данные. Подобный подход поддерживает быструю передачу страниц и правильную обработку сервисов. Без сценариев большинство актуальных порталов не могли-бы ап икс бы действовать в обычном режиме.
Браузерные сценарии выполняются в интернет-обозревателе а-также предназначены для поведение страницы после-момента ее открытия. Они имеют-возможность разворачивать выпадающие списки, показывать уведомления, изменять табы, проверять формы плюс обновлять часть контента без-применения полной перезагрузки экрана. Служебные скрипты работают на части хостинга. Такие-сценарии проверяют информацию, фиксируют сведения, управляют клиентскими записями а-также передают результат назад во интерфейс.
Оптимизация действий с использованием скриптов
Главной из ключевых направлений применения скриптов считается автоматическое-выполнение. Посредством сценариев применением можно закрывать рутинные задачи up x без самостоятельного вмешательства. К-примеру, обработка документов, дублирующее архивирование информации, подготовка сред а-также выполнение приложений на-основе таймеру.
Автоматическое-выполнение помогает сберегать усилия а-также уменьшать частоту неточностей. Сценарии выполняют операции строго на-основе определенным условиям, это создает предсказуемость результата. Данный-фактор особенно значимо во-время работе с большими объемами сведений а-также развитыми средами.
Базовый командный-сценарий имеет-возможность изменять-названия файлы согласно заданному правилу, отправлять файлы в нужные каталоги, контролировать доступность обновлений а-также удалять временные директории. Значительно развитые скрипты способны получать сведения из разных источников, проверять значения, формировать отчеты плюс отправлять ап икс официальный сайт оповещения. В-рамках таких случаях скрипт выступает не-просто только дополнительным модулем, зато элементом полноценного операционного сценария.
Задействование сценариев в инфраструктурном обслуживании
Инфраструктурные специалисты постоянно используют сценарии с-целью управления инфраструктурой а-также ресурсами. Посредством сценариев помощью возможно автоматически обновлять системное ПО, мониторить работоспособность системы а-также действовать в-случае изменения.
Скрипты помогают соединить множество команд внутри общий сценарий. Допустим, возможно сформировать сценарий, который отслеживает работоспособность хоста, удаляет кэшированные данные и отправляет сообщение в-случае появлении ошибки. Такой подход повышает результативность функционирования плюс облегчает мониторинг по системой.
В управления сценарии часто задействуются для контроля. Данные-сценарии способны ап икс контролировать оставшееся место на накопителе, загруженность процессора, работоспособность network каналов а-также работоспособность важных служб. Когда показатель переходит за разрешенные границы, скрипт записывает инцидент либо активирует вспомогательное операцию. Это дает-возможность скорее выявлять неисправности а-также сохранять надежность системной экосистемы.
Командные-сценарии в подготовке сведений
Во-время работе со сведениями командные-сценарии задействуются для данных получения, анализа а-также нормализации. Такие-сценарии позволяют без-ручного-участия обрабатывать значительные массивы данных, извлекать нужные показатели а-также генерировать документы. Это особенно важно для аналитике а-также научных работах.
Командные-сценарии могут выполнять отбор сведений, распределение, объединение листов и иные процессы. За-счет такому-подходу процесс анализа становится быстрее а-также значительно структурированным. Ручная проверка с большими наборами информации заменяется системными процессами.
Например, командный-сценарий способен получить таблицу с тысячами рядов, очистить повторы, перевести значения-дат ко общему формату, выявить пропущенные поля плюс сформировать итоговый документ. Без-автоматизации такая задача занимает значительное-количество времени и нередко связана-с up x неточностями. Программный сценарий проводит аналогичные подобные действия стабильно во-время каждом запуске. Такой-подход делает итог более стабильным а-также удобным для дальнейшего использования.
Значение сценариев в тестировании ПО
Проверка цифрового обеспечения также активно задействует сценарии. Они дают-возможность самостоятельно тестировать работу функций, форм а-также системных элементов. Подобная-проверка помогает выявлять сбои на первых этапах разработки.
Скрипты ради проверки проводят определенные сценарии а-также проверяют ответ с заданным. В-случае нахождении расхождений платформа фиксирует сбой. Данный механизм снижает объем-работы на разработчиков а-также увеличивает надежность конечного ап икс официальный сайт ПО.
Программные валидации особенно полезны во-время частых апдейтах. По-завершении обновления кода скрипт способен быстро запуститься по-основным важным возможностям а-также вывести, не нарушилась ли функционирование уже реализованных компонентов. Подобный механизм называется регрессионным валидацией. Процесс дает-возможность контролировать качество продукта и уменьшает вероятность возникновения неочевидных дефектов вслед-за обновлений.
Командные-сценарии в деловых системах
Сценарии задействуются не только в создании-систем и администрировании. Они еще применяются во деловых программах, таблицах, решениях документооборота и инструментах. К-примеру, командный-сценарий способен самостоятельно подставлять формы, валидировать данные в таблицах, генерировать отчеты и пересылать данные к внешние системы.
В электронных таблицах сценарии позволяют проводить расчеты, объединять данные со нескольких таблиц, фильтровать лишние данные плюс формировать итоговые ап икс документы. Это в-особенности удобно в-условиях регулярной взаимодействии с повторяющимися наборами. Вместо ручного-выполнения одних плюс таких-же же действий можно сформировать сценарий, который выполнит процесс на-основе изначально заданной структуре.
Сценарии во интерфейсах плюс системах
Многие системы применяют командные-сценарии для управления поведения отдельных частей. Скрипт способен инициировать проверку поля, изменять статус интерфейса, подгружать up x внешние информацию либо показывать hint. Подобные действия создают систему значительно логичным плюс быстрым.
На-уровне программ сценарии обычно работают в-фоновом-режиме. Скрипты помогают согласовывать данные, записывать настройки, управлять уведомлениями а-также запускать фоновые действия. Для-конечного конечного пользователя подобная-логика выражается во значительно надежной а-также комфортной работе системы. При сам сценарий является технической частью платформы, которая создает заданный алгоритм процессов.
Сравнение между сценарием плюс полноценной программой
Скрипт и традиционная система способны быть похожи по-внешнему результирующему результату, но разнятся в назначению а-также объему. Приложение обычно обладает намного развитую ап икс официальный сайт архитектуру, собственный UI, комплект компонентов а-также продолжительный этап разработки. Сценарий чаще выполняет конкретную операцию и исполняется внутри предварительно готовой системы.
Это не означает, что скрипты обязательно базовые. Часть скрипты могут быть довольно крупными а-также включать развитую логику. Тем-не-менее их ключевая черта заключается в практическом применении. Командный-сценарий формируется ради выполнения конкретного шага: обработать документ, передать обращение, проверить сведения, выполнить сценарий а-также соединить несколько систем ап икс между собой.